
Description
Cimmerian daggers are linked to the early Iron Age and are known for their practical proportions and utilitarian design.
Based on historical context, similar weapons are generally dated to approximately the 9th to 7th century BC.
During this period, iron was the primary material used for blades, reflecting early advancements in metalworking technology.
